Are you a foreign-educated lawyer or LL.M. student facing the U.S. bar exam? You are not alone.

Each year, thousands of talented international attorneys attempt the New York or California bar exam, only to face pass rates significantly lower than their U.S.-trained peers. The reasons are clear: you're not just learning new laws, you're battling a different legal system, a unique testing style, and a language barrier—all on a compressed timeline. This guide is the first of its kind written specifically for you.

Forget generic bar prep advice. This book provides a targeted, practical, and empathetic roadmap to conquer the specific challenges you face. It translates the confusing aspects of the common law and demystifies the bar exam's structure, giving you the tools to bridge the gap between your legal education and a passing score.

Inside, you will discover:

A Crash Course in Common Law: Finally understand core principles like stare decisis and the adversarial system from a civil law perspective, preventing critical mistakes on exam day.

Targeted MBE Strategies: Learn why the Multistate Bar Examination is the biggest hurdle for foreign takers and master a step-by-step method to deconstruct tricky questions, manage your time, and improve your reading comprehension of legal English.

The IRAC Formula for Essays: Move beyond theoretical writing and learn the rigid IRAC (Issue, Rule, Application, Conclusion) structure that bar graders are trained to look for on the MEE and MPT.

Customized Study Schedules: Implement a realistic 6 or 9-month study plan designed for the demanding life of an LL.M. student, integrating commercial bar prep courses effectively.

Real Advice from Successful Foreign Attorneys: Gain invaluable insights and learn to avoid common mistakes from international lawyers who have successfully passed the U.S. bar exam.

A Guide to What Comes Next: Navigate the Character and Fitness evaluation, the MPRE, and the unique challenges of job searching in the U.S. as a foreign-admitted attorney.
